php - MySQL - 插入多个插入,页面停止工作

标签 php mysql

我做了一个 makegroup.php 站点,它应该创建一个组,并将这个人放在 UserID 和 GroupID 之间的连接表中。

..但我不确定如何继续。登录用户保存在 session 变量 $usid 中​​,但是 GroupID 呢?如何在另一页之后立即获取它?我需要分步进行吗? Including quick DB scheme.

提前致谢。

最佳答案

我猜 GrouID 是自动数字的?

所以你让 db 为你创建 id。

也好像您正在尝试连接 $groupname

 $sql = "INSERT INTO group (Groupname) VALUES ('".$groupname."') ";

但你不想这样做,因为该方法容易受到 SQL 注入(inject)攻击

改用参数化值

How can I prevent SQL injection in PHP?

关于php - MySQL - 插入多个插入,页面停止工作,我们在Stack Overflow上找到一个类似的问题: https://stackoverflow.com/questions/33940594/

相关文章:

php - Omnipay 不为 Paypal 加税

mysql - SQL难题非常接近解决但无法获得parentid

mysql 唯一(多个键)

PHP对象编程如何在MYSQL中保存数据

php - 尝试自动将外键值插入到我的 mysql 表中

PHP PDO 准备语句绑定(bind) NULL 值

php - 在 PHP 中通过 ODBC(使用 PDO)查询 Snowflake 返回不正确的数据

php - 根据上下文对 MySQL 结果进行排序

python - URL : Binary Blob, Unicode 或编码的 Unicode 字符串?

php - 一段时间后 apc_fetch 返回 false